The Dark Reality of Pornhub
[00:00 - 02:29]
Mickelwait opens with a stark revelation: "PornHub is not a porn site. It's a crime scene." She explains that approximately five years prior, she uncovered that Pornhub allowed virtually anyone with an email address to upload content without verifying age or consent. This lack of oversight led to a proliferation of illegal and abusive materials, including child sexual abuse and non-consensual violence.
- Key Points:
- Pornhub was the fifth most trafficked website globally in 2019 with 56 million pieces of content uploaded annually.
- Minimal barriers to uploading led to vast amounts of illegal content, including videos of real sexual crimes, child abuse, and revenge porn.
- The platform’s simplistic upload process bypassed essential checks for age and consent, making it a hub for criminal activity.
Notable Quote:
"They were not verifying ID to make sure that these were not children, and they were not verifying consent to make sure that these are not rape or trafficking victims." – 00:05
The Evolution and Ownership of Pornhub
[03:54 - 07:50]
Mickelwait provides a historical overview of Pornhub's ownership, revealing that it is owned by MindGeek, a conglomerate that controls most of the world's major porn sites. She traces the company’s origins, pointing out a series of rebrandings and legal troubles, including tax evasion and money laundering, before ending up under the new name Alo.
- Key Points:
- MindGeek consolidated the global porn industry, owning brands like Playboy Digital, RedTube, YouPorn, and more.
- The company has a history of legal issues, leading to frequent sales and rebrandings.
- Despite changes in ownership, the core issues within Pornhub persisted, culminating in recent criminal charges related to sex trafficking.
Notable Quote:
"Pornhub is owned by a parent company called MindGeek, which acquired most of the world’s popular porn sites through a $362 million loan from Colbeck Capital." – 04:04
Initiating the Trafficking Hub Movement
[07:50 - 14:12]
Chris Williamson inquires about Mickelwait's personal journey in uncovering the crimes on Pornhub. Mickelwait shares her long-term involvement in combating sex trafficking and how unsettling news stories in early 2020 propelled her to take action. On February 1, 2020, after testing Pornhub’s upload system herself, she launched the #TraffickingHub movement, which rapidly gained traction.
- Key Points:
- Mickelwait's advocacy began with noticing disturbing stories, such as a 15-year-old girl’s rescue after being identified in Pornhub videos.
- Her hashtag #TraffickingHub resonated globally, amassing 2.3 million signatures and involving 600 organizations.
- Media coverage, including a pivotal New York Times expose, amplified the movement, leading to substantial pressure on Pornhub.
Notable Quote:
"Anytime you monetize an act, a sex act that involves a minor… this is a trafficking hub." – 08:18
The Collapse of Pornhub’s Content Empire
[14:12 - 18:46]
Mickelwait explains how cutting off financial ties through credit card companies forced Pornhub to drastically reduce its content. Without access to monetization avenues, Pornhub deleted 91% of its videos in an unprecedented move, which Financial Times described as possibly the largest content takedown in Internet history.
- Key Points:
- Pornhub’s business model relied heavily on ad revenue, with 4.6 billion ad impressions daily.
- The deletion of content stemmed from internal revelations about inadequate moderation, with only 10 moderators handling millions of videos.
- Despite significant content removal, ongoing lawsuits and class actions demand further deletions and accountability.
Notable Quote:
"They were selling 4.6 billion ad impressions on Pornhub every single day." – 14:20
Legal Battles and Internal Failings
[18:46 - 29:57]
Mickelwait details the legal confrontations Pornhub faces, including nearly 300 victims in 27 lawsuits. The revelations from internal documents highlight the company's negligence and deliberate inaction in reporting and removing illegal content. The company’s ineffective moderation system and policies failed to protect vulnerable individuals, resulting in severe psychological trauma for victims.
- Key Points:
- Legal discovery exposed that Pornhub employed only one person to review 706,000 flagged videos.
- Strategies like requiring 15 flags before a video is reviewed allowed abusive content to persist unchecked.
- Victims like Serena, a 13-year-old abused on the site, illustrate the profound personal impact of Pornhub's failures.
Notable Quote:
"The only choice they had at that point when the credit card companies cut them off was in an attempt to woo back the credit card companies." – 16:04

The Impact of Internal Documents and Legal Discoveries
[41:19 - 51:24]
The accidental release of internal documents from court cases has been instrumental in exposing Pornhub’s malpractices. Mickelwait discusses how these documents reveal intentional policies that ignored and profited from illegal content, strengthening the case for criminal prosecution of Pornhub’s leadership.
- Key Points:
- Discovery processes in litigation have unveiled extensive internal communications highlighting deliberate negligence.
- Judges have consistently rejected Pornhub’s attempts to shield themselves under Section 230 of the CDA.
- The internal push to monetize categories like "teen" has been particularly egregious, leading to substantial legal repercussions.
Notable Quote:
"Out of the employees they had 1800 working for Pornhub and MindGeek, and they employed one person to be reviewing videos flagged by users as containing rape, child abuse, or other terms of service violations." – 27:22
Alliances and Support in the Campaign
[51:24 - 65:55]
Mickelwait shares her experiences in garnering support from unexpected allies, including former Pornhub owners and influential figures like Bill Ackman. These alliances were crucial in pressuring financial institutions to sever ties with Pornhub, culminating in significant content deletions and ongoing legal battles.
- Key Points:
- Former owner Fabian Tillman provided insider information, revealing hidden shareholders involved in Pornhub’s operations.
- Bill Ackman, motivated by personal reasons, played a key role in persuading Visa and MasterCard to withdraw services from Pornhub.
- Collaborations with porn performers and industry insiders highlighted widespread dissatisfaction with Pornhub’s practices, further strengthening the movement.
Notable Quote:
"He had read the Children of Pornhub New York Times article and he was incensed because he has daughters of his own." – 44:09
